债务纠纷Springboot读取配置⽂件
⾸先,物品们需要知道,Spring boot 的核⼼思想是约定⼤于配置的,这当然也体现在了配置⽂件的位置上。演员刘莉莉老公
Spring boot 启动会扫描以下位置的application.properties 或者l⽂件作为spring boot 的默认配置⽂件 ,加载的优先由上到下,加载的时候,会把以下路劲的⽂件都加载⼀遍。不同的配置内容会全部加载到系统,对于重复的配置内容,优先级别⾼的配置⽂件内容会覆盖优先级别低的配置⽂件内容。
Spring boot 配置⽂件 默认等级
除了上述的⽂件⽬录以外,还可以⽤fig.location 参数的形式指定配置⽂件 :java -jar spring-boot-02-config-02-0.0.1-SNAPSHOT.jar --fig.location=G:/application.properties ,如果上述的
默认路劲有配置⽂件的话,会和配置内容会形成互补作⽤,相同的内容优先级别⾼的会覆盖优先级别低的。陈长生是谁的孩子
陈伟霆 阿saSpring Bo o t 读取配置⽂件的⽅式可以分为
Spr ing Bo
1. 注解
1.1 、直接获取值到字段上
@Value("${st}");
1.2 、指定配置⽂件path
@PropertySource("classpath:config/my.prop")
1.3、指定配置⽂件前缀
@ConfigurationProperties(prefix = “aaa”)
2. 获取 Spring Boot 的环境变量
贷款工资证明范本
2.1、主类
ConfigurableApplicationContext ctx = SpringApplication.run(SpringbootPropertiesApplication.class, args);
2.2、注⼊环境变量
@Autowired
private Environment env; Property("test");
读取配置文件失败